Title: How to Make Authentic Chana Masala at Home | Easy Step-by-Step Guide

Introduction:
Chana Masala, a popular North Indian dish made with chickpeas in a rich tomato-based sauce, is a staple in many Indian restaurants. While it may seem intimidating to make at home, with this easy recipe, you can create a flavorful and authentic Chana Masala in the comfort of your own kitchen. Ingredients:

  • 1 cup dried chickpeas, soaked overnight and drained
  • 2 medium onions, ch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 medium tomato, diced
  • 2 tablespoons ghee or vegetable oil
  • 1 teaspoon ground cumin
  • 1 teaspoon ground coriander
  • 1 teaspoon ground cayenne pepper
  • Salt, to taste
  • 2 tablespoons lemon juice
  • 2 tablespoons chopped fresh cilantro
  • Basmati rice, for serving

Step-by-Step Cooking Instructions:

  1. Rinse the chickpeas and drain well. In a blender or food processor, puree the chickpeas with 1/4 cup water until smooth.
  2. Heat the ghee or oil in a large saucepan over medium heat. Add the cumin, coriander, and cayenne pepper and cook, stirring, for 1 minute.
  3. Add the onion and cook, stirring occasionally, until softened, about 5 minutes. Add the garlic and cook for 1 minute.
  4. Add the tomato and cook, stirring occasionally, until they break down, about 5 minutes.
  5. Add the chickpea puree, salt, and lemon juice. Stir to combine.
  6. Reduce the heat to low and simmer, stirring occasionally, for 10-15 minutes or until the sauce has thickened.
  7. Taste and adjust the seasoning. Serve the Chana Masala over cooked Basmati rice.

Serving Suggestions & Variations:
Pair your Chana Masala with Basmati rice, naan, or roti for a filling meal. Add some crispy onions, chopped cilantro, or a dollop of raita (a yogurt and cucumber sauce) for extra texture and flavor. Consider substituting the tomato with roasted tomatoes for a slightly different flavor profile.
